MySQL JAR包下载位置指南
下载的mysql的jar包在哪里

首页 2025-06-25 22:03:57



下载的MySQL JDBC驱动(JAR包)在哪里?全面指南与深度解析 在Java开发中,与MySQL数据库进行交互是再常见不过的任务

    为了实现这一功能,我们需要MySQL的JDBC(Java Database Connectivity)驱动

    这个驱动通常以JAR(Java ARchive)包的形式提供,它包含了与MySQL数据库通信所需的类和方法

    然而,对于初学者或偶尔进行数据库开发的程序员来说,找到并正确配置这个JAR包可能会成为一个小障碍

    本文将详细探讨“下载的MySQL JDBC驱动(JAR包)在哪里”这一问题,并提供全面的指南和深度解析,帮助你轻松解决这一难题

     一、理解MySQL JDBC驱动 在深入探讨之前,首先我们需要理解什么是JDBC驱动

    JDBC是Java提供的一套用于执行SQL语句的API,它允许Java应用程序与各种数据库进行连接和操作

    MySQL JDBC驱动则是这套API的一个具体实现,专为MySQL数据库设计

    通过这个驱动,Java程序可以轻松地与MySQL数据库建立连接、执行SQL语句、处理结果集等

     二、获取MySQL JDBC驱动的JAR包 现在,让我们聚焦于“下载的MySQL JDBC驱动(JAR包)在哪里”这一核心问题

    通常,你可以通过以下几种方式获取这个JAR包: 1.MySQL官方网站 MySQL官方网站是获取官方JDBC驱动的首选之地

    你可以访问MySQL的官方网站(例如,mysql.com),在下载页面中找到JDBC驱动的下载链接

    通常,这个页面会提供不同版本的JDBC驱动,以适应不同版本的MySQL数据库和Java运行环境

    确保选择与你的MySQL数据库版本和Java版本兼容的驱动版本

     2.Maven中央仓库 如果你在使用Maven作为构建工具,那么获取MySQL JDBC驱动将变得非常简单

    只需在你的`pom.xml`文件中添加相应的依赖项即可

    Maven会自动从中央仓库下载并包含所需的JAR包

    例如: xml mysql mysql-connector-java 8.0.XX替换为具体版本号 --> 3.Gradle构建工具 类似于Maven,如果你在使用Gradle作为构建工具,你也可以通过添加依赖项来自动下载MySQL JDBC驱动

    在你的`build.gradle`文件中添加以下内容: groovy dependencies{ implementation mysql:mysql-connector-java:8.0.XX //替换为具体版本号 } 4.其他第三方库管理工具 除了Maven和Gradle之外,还有其他第三方库管理工具如Ivy、SBT等,它们也支持从中央仓库或私有仓库下载MySQL JDBC驱动

    具体使用方法可以参考相应工具的文档

     三、配置MySQL JDBC驱动的JAR包 获取到JAR包之后,接下来你需要将其配置到你的Java项目中

    配置方法取决于你使用的开发环境和构建工具

    以下是一些常见的配置方法: 1.IDE内置项目结构配置 如果你在使用IDE(如IntelliJ IDEA、Eclipse等),通常可以通过IDE内置的项目结构配置功能来添加JAR包

    例如,在IntelliJ IDEA中,你可以通过“Project Structure”对话框中的“Libraries”选项卡来添加JAR包;在Eclipse中,则可以通过“Build Path”对话框中的“Libraries”选项卡来完成这一操作

     2.手动添加到类路径 如果你不使用任何IDE或构建工具,而是手动编译和运行Java程序,那么你需要将JAR包手动添加到类路径中

    这通常通过在运行Java命令时指定`-cp`或`-classpath`选项来实现

    例如: bash java -cp .;mysql-connector-java-8.0.XX.jar YourMainClass 注意:在Windows系统中,类路径分隔符是分号(`;`);在Unix/Linux系统中,则是冒号(`:`)

     3.使用构建工具的类路径管理 如果你在使用Maven或Gradle等构建工具,那么类路径的管理将自动由这些工具完成

    只需确保你的依赖项配置正确即可

     四、验证配置是否正确 配置完成后,你需要验证MySQL JDBC驱动是否正确加载

    这通常可以通过尝试与MySQL数据库建立连接来实现

    以下是一个简单的示例代码: java import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; public class MySQLConnectionTest{ public static void main(String【】 args){ String url = jdbc:mysql://localhost:3306/yourdatabase; String user = yourusername; String password = yourpassword; try{ Connection connection = DriverManager.getConnection(url, user, password); System.out.println(Connection successful!); connection.close(); } catch(SQLException e){ e.printStackTrace(); } } } 运行这段代码,如果输出“Connection successful!”,则表示MySQL JDBC驱动已成功加载,并且你的程序能够与MySQL数据库建立连接

     五、常见问题与解决方案 在配置MySQL JDBC驱动的过

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密